Strewn along the banks of the Kennebec River in Central Maine, Waterville is a quaint small town brimming with historic charm and modern delights. Downtown Waterville is vibrant with an array of eclectic shops and diverse eateries in well-preserved historic buildings. The town’s popular farmers’ market, boasting local produce and handcrafted artisan goods, is also held downtown throughout the year.
Waterville is home to two institutions of higher education—Colby College and Thomas College. As a result, the town has a thriving cultural scene, with mainstays such as the Colby College Museum of Art, Waterville Opera House, Redington Museum, and Railroad Square Cinema.
Waterville’s close-knit community comes together for a variety of family-friendly events, including the Waterville Intown Arts Fest, Taste of Greater Waterville, and the Maine International Film Festival. Locals also enjoy congregating to engage in outdoor fun at Quarry Road Recreation Area and on the Kennebec River.
